So, 'Fuck Off I Love You' is this quirky blend of comedy, drama, and romance that really dives into the complexities of modern relationships. Alvin, the main character, is navigating the murky waters of his past while trying to write this book about love. There's a certain rawness to his journey that feels both relatable and painfully real. The pacing has a nice rhythm, oscillating between laugh-out-loud moments and gut-wrenching introspection. The performances are honest, particularly from Alvin, who brings a tangible depth to his character. It's unique how it doesn't shy away from the darker sides of love and memory, which gives it an edge. The mix of humor and heartache is honestly refreshing, making it a standout in the genre.
